Members of the United Methodist Men strive: - To encourage knowledge of and support for the total mission of The United Methodist Church
- To engage in evangelism by sharing the fullness of the gospel in its personal and social dimensions
- To clarify and speak to the identity and role of the men in contemporary society
- To seek commitment to discipleship
- To study and become familiar with The United Methodist Church, its organization, doctrines, and beliefs
- To cooperate with all units of United Methodist Men in obtaining these objectives through district, conference, jurisdiction, and church-wide goals.
The General Commission on United Methodist Men (GCUMM) challenges all United Methodist Men charter units to: - Make a commitment to Spiritual Growth of Every Man in the local church
- Make a call for a few men in every church to support and encourage pastors through prayer and service
- Make a call and equip all men to have at least one godly friend with whom he is accountable as a disciple of Christ and to encourage men to build friendships across racial and cultural lines
- Declare young people our new mission field, and call and equip adults to lead young people into authentic Christian adulthood
We encourage each individual to: - Engage daily in Bible Study.
- Bear witness to Christ's way in daily work and in all personal contacts through words and actions.
- Engage in some definite Christian service.
